First Annual Reiter Cup Poker Run Scores a Full House

With over 40 boats and 150 people in attendance on June 13, 2009, the 1st Annual Reiter Cup Poker Run proved to be a huge success. This particular poker run was formed in memory of Pat Reiter, a very dear friend to the Maryland Powerboat Club, who died in a tragic boating accident last October on the Patuxent River. The proceeds for this first annual event went to the Geriatric Oncology Consortium (GOC).
 
During a normal poker run, the participants of the event travel to five different locations and draw a card upon arrival at each location. The player with the best poker hand wins the money collected for that hand. However, this particular Poker Run involved only four locations instead of five. Beginning at the Tiki Bar, the poker run migrated to Sea Breeze Restaurant & Crab House in Hollywood, Maryland, then to the Rivers Edge Restaurant in Benedict, Maryland, and finally to Vera's White Sands Beach Club & Marina in Lusby. Vera's White Sands involved a 2-card hand.
 
Each stop also entailed a 50/50 raffle drawing where the members of the Maryland Powerboat Club were able to give away items graciously donated by each of the businesses involved in this year's 1st Annual Reiter Cup Poker Run. In addition, there were two winners from this poker run. Jay Worch and Kelly Davis both pulled in $1,180.0 with Worch winning "Best Captain's Hand" and Davis winning "Best Crew Hand."
